The Forest Heart region boasts a unique history, having played a pivotal role as an inspiration during Finland’s Golden Age of Art (approx. 1880-1910). The region’s distinctive natural features and stunning landscapes sparked the creativity of the era’s top artists. Their work and art shaped the region’s legacy as a significant hub of Finnish art and culture, a reputation that endures to this day.
Masterpieces of the Golden Age are only one facet of our rich art and culture scene. Contemporary art, with its ever-evolving and vibrant expressions, takes centre stage in thought-provoking and must-see events. Expect bold, provocative exhibitions.
Culture and art extend beyond the frames, galleries, and museums. The region’s buildings – from factories and churches to modern structures – are themselves works of art and culture, celebrated for their architectural beauty.
